Forward Guidance

No explicit forward guidance tied to SOJF’s performance is included in the Q3 2000 filing. Fixed income analysts note that junior subordinated notes of this type typically have performance drivers tied to three core factors: the issuer’s ongoing ability to meet debt service obligations, shifts in prevailing long-term interest rate environments, and changes to the issuer’s corporate credit rating. These factors could potentially impact SOJF’s market valuation for current and future holders, though no specific projections for these variables were included in the Q3 2000 disclosures.
